a gorgeous soft-light midwinter's morning in wellington. the sun took it's time, languidly teasing at the clouds for hours, before finally burning them away around midday.

 

This view taken from beside the Interisland Ferry terminal at Aotea Quay. That's Oriental Bay in the background (across the harbour), and Roseneath on the hill above. both in the ritziest categories of any local real-estate catalogue.

pacific faithful (lloyds no. 9123099, voyage no. PFL0010) loads off at aotea quay berth 5.

 

the stevedores certainly don't mess around; pacific faithful docked less than two hours earlier. she departed 17hr after arrival. wellington harbour is a very different place to the one I encountered as a school-leaver in the mid-80's.
